Introduction

Drug Testing is a crucial aspect of medical lab procedures, especially in the context of ensuring public safety and compliance with Regulations. However, it is essential to minimize the occurrence of false positives in Drug Testing to prevent unnecessary stress and confusion for patients. In this article, we will discuss various measures that can be taken in a medical lab setting to minimize the occurrence of false positives in Drug Testing, with a specific focus on the role of phlebotomists in this process.

Regular Calibration and Maintenance of Equipment

One of the key factors that can contribute to false positives in Drug Testing is the lack of proper calibration and maintenance of equipment. Inaccurate results can be generated if the equipment used in the testing process is not functioning correctly. To minimize the occurrence of false positives, medical labs should establish a regular schedule for calibration and maintenance of all testing equipment.

Proper Training and Certification of Phlebotomists

Phlebotomists play a crucial role in the Drug Testing process, as they are responsible for collecting blood samples from patients. Improper collection techniques or contamination of samples can lead to false positives in Drug Testing. To prevent this, it is essential for phlebotomists to undergo proper training and certification to ensure that they are following best practices in sample collection.

  1. Phlebotomists should be trained in proper Venipuncture techniques to ensure that blood samples are collected accurately and without contamination.
  2. They should also be educated on the importance of proper labeling and handling of samples to prevent mix-ups and ensure the integrity of the testing process.
  3. Certification programs for phlebotomists should include examinations to assess their knowledge and skills in sample collection, handling, and documentation.

Implementing Strict Quality Control Measures

Another important factor in minimizing false positives in Drug Testing is the implementation of strict Quality Control measures in the medical lab setting. Quality Control processes help to ensure the accuracy and reliability of Test Results, reducing the likelihood of false positives.

  1. Internal Quality Control measures, such as running known control samples alongside patient samples, can help to identify any potential issues with the testing process.
  2. External Quality Control programs, which involve sending samples to external laboratories for verification, can provide an additional layer of assurance regarding the accuracy of Test Results.
  3. Regular audits and inspections of the lab procedures and documentation can help to identify any areas for improvement and ensure that all staff are following best practices in Drug Testing.
